在ArchLinux中手動安裝Brackets

我們已經看到了 en DesdeLinux 新的開源編輯器 HTML, 的CSS y JavaScript的土磚 通過在 MIT 許可證下分發它來創建並提供給所有人。 是的,令人難以置信 土磚 已發布開源產品。

土磚 是一家提供與設計、多媒體和網絡技術相關的非常好的產品的公司,到目前為止,所有這些產品都必須支付許可證才能長期使用它們。 Photoshop中, , Dreamweaver中他們只是其中的一個例子。

括號 這不是第一步 土磚 給予世界 開源的,已經在 DesdeLinux 我們已經看到 大約一年前,他們發布了一個名為 來源沒有專業 (與我們的主題使用的相同:P)在 SIL 開放字體許可證 1.1。

我們也看到了 如何安裝 en Ubuntu的13.04 好消息是,它也可以在存儲庫中找到 AUR de ArchLinux的,所以在終端中輸入應該足夠了:

$ yaourt -S brackets-git

但事實證明我沒有使用 Yaourt,並且當嘗試使用以下命令創建安裝包時 製作包,我需要一些也在 AUR 中的依賴項。 簡而言之,工作量太大了。

Ya 我已經降低了 二進制格式 德布。 將其安裝在 德比安·威茲(Debian Wheezy),但由於依賴性問題,這是不可能的。 在我寫這篇文章時,Brackets 網站已關閉。

事實證明,一個 德布。 它裡面的文件必須放在某些文件夾中,例如 括號 en / usr /共享/,也就是說,理論上,如果我複制每個文件夾指示的所有內容,我可以執行 括號。 確實如此。

我解壓了 德布。 運用 方舟,我留下了一個名為 括號-sprint-28-LINUX64。 我轉到該文件夾並解壓縮該文件。 數據.tar.gz,這為我創建了一個名為的文件夾 USR。 我通過終端訪問它並運行:

$ sudo cp bin/brackets /usr/bin/ $ sudo cp -R lib/brackets/ /usr/lib64/ $ sudo cp -R share/applications/brackets.desktop /usr/share/applications/ $ sudo cp share/icons /hicolor/scalable/apps/brackets.svg /usr/share/icons/hicolor/scalable/apps/

幾秒鐘後我就已經有了以下圖標 括號 在菜單中,但是當我運行時什麼也沒有發生。 我通過終端完成了它,它開始向我拋出錯誤:

/usr/lib/brackets/Brackets:加載共享庫時出錯:libplc4.so.0d:無法打開共享對象文件:沒有這樣的文件或目錄 /usr/lib/brackets/Brackets:加載共享庫時出錯:libnspr4.so .0d:無法打開共享對象文件:沒有這樣的文件或目錄 /usr/lib/brackets/Brackets:加載共享庫時出錯:libudev.so.0:無法打開共享對象文件:沒有這樣的文件或目錄

剩下的很簡單,我只需在終端中輸入:

$ sudo ln -sf /lib64/libplc4.so /lib64/libplc4.so.0d $ sudo ln -sf /lib64/libnspr4.so /lib64/libnspr4.so.0d $ sudo ln -sf /lib64/libudev.so / lib64/libudev.so.0

準備好了。 我已經有了 Brackets,無需那麼麻煩 ArchLinux的.

括號

我會徹底測試並進行比較 括號與 SublimeText。 😉


發表您的評論

您的電子郵件地址將不會被發表。 必填字段標有 *

*

*

  1. 負責數據:MiguelÁngelGatón
  2. 數據用途:控制垃圾郵件,註釋管理。
  3. 合法性:您的同意
  4. 數據通訊:除非有法律義務,否則不會將數據傳達給第三方。
  5. 數據存儲:Occentus Networks(EU)託管的數據庫
  6. 權利:您可以隨時限制,恢復和刪除您的信息。

  1.   曼努埃爾·德拉·富恩特 他說:

    請注意:Yaourt 永遠不會與 sudo 一起使用。 你看,我已經一遍又一遍地向你重複過,但你似乎堅持要按你的方式去做。 xd

    1.    拉夫 他說:

      伙計,作為一個很好的安全建議,但是拜託,每個人都知道他們用計算機做什麼。 我一開始就不使用 Yaourt,但我會在文章中糾正這一點 😛

      1.    埃利奧時間3000 他說:

        在這一點上我同意你的觀點。 另外,我不使用 SUDO,所以我通常將其視為另一個麻煩,因為事實是該系統可以使您避免出現問題,但它通常比 Windows Vista 中的 UAC 更不舒服。

    2.    埃利奧時間3000 他說:

      SUDO 也是如此。 如果您注意到很多時候您安裝的應用程序通常需要 root 才能安裝,那確實很麻煩。

    3.    另一個dl用戶 他說:

      為什麼不在yaourt中使用SUDO?

      1.    py_崩潰 他說:

        如果您在 yaourt 中使用 sudo,您將面臨向 PKGBUILD 中發現的某些惡意腳本授予管理員權限的風險。 此外,yaourt 在安裝軟件包時會要求您輸入 sudo 密碼,因此您無需從一開始就輸入它。

  2.   胡安安東尼奧 他說:

    我能夠在 Trisquel 中安裝它😀我想分享它給我可以寫電子郵件貢獻的人

    1.    胡安安東尼奧 他說:

      ????

  3.   以色列 他說:

    菜單使用的字體可以更改嗎?

  4.   格雷戈里奧·埃斯帕達斯(Gregorio Espadas) 他說:

    我明白為什麼下載頁面被關閉了... sprint-29 現已可用,不幸的是您發現事情已經發生了變化,並且本文中的安裝說明不再適用。 哎呀呀呀,又到了更新的時間了😉

    1.    拉夫 他說:

      哈哈哈,我就是這個地方。

    2.    以色列 他說:

      如果你是對的,雖然它也沒有太大變化,但你在解壓縮文件時必須使用 opt 文件夾..雖然我可以正常工作..如果他們更新帖子,我會看看我是否做對了步驟哈哈哈

  5.   喬恩85p 他說:

    $ sudo ln -sf /lib64/libudev.so /lib64/libudev.so.0
    朋友,你應該澄清一下,這條線只適用於你的計算機,我作為新手使用它,我無法啟動我的系統,因為我的文件是 libudev.so.0.13.1 XD 。
    我已經更正了它,它只是更改了符號鏈接。
    問候

  6.   魯道夫 他說:

    您好,非常好的文章,向您致以問候,我邀請您嘗試 BSD。

  7.   Mrkzboo 他說:

    非常感謝,這對我有幫助,但要讓它在 Fedora 18 上運行😀
    問候。

  8.   費德里科 他說:

    當我嘗試在命令行上執行安裝步驟時,出現以下錯誤:

    sudo cp -R lib/括號/ /usr/lib64/
    cp: 無法在“lib/brackets/”上“stat”:沒有這樣的文件或目錄
    當我在 data/usr/ 文件夾中解壓 Brackets.Release.0.42.64 位時,既沒有 lib 也沒有 lib/brackets/

  9.   費德里科 他說:

    Sublime Text 的安裝對我來說也不起作用。 :::: 打開程序但從未顯示它......甚至不顯示同一文件夾中的可執行文件。

  10.   約斯巴尼斯·維森特 他說:

    您好,我需要有關此支架安裝的幫助,與 Federico 一樣的事情也發生在我身上,我不知道該怎麼辦,我知道自這篇文章發布以來已經過去了,但我找不到另一篇可以幫助我的文章。 請有人能幫助我。謝謝

  11.   雅各 他說:

    在最新版本中,您只需使用 ARK 解壓它,在剛剛解壓的文件夾中的 opt 中打開一個終端並運行:

    sudo cp -R 括號 /opt

    準備好了! 🙂